#c69860 color RGB value is (198,152,96). #c69860 color name is Custom Color color.

#c69860 hex color red value is 198, green value is 152 and the blue value of its RGB is 96.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#c69860 hue: 0.09, saturation: 0.47 and the lightness value of c69860 is 0.58.

The process color (four color CMYK) of #c69860 color hex is 0.00, 0.23, 0.52, 0.22. Web safe color of #c69860 is #cc9966. Color #c69860 contains mainly ORANGE color.

About #C69860 Custom Color

#C69860 (Custom Color) is a orange-based color with RGB values of 198, 152, 96. This color belongs to the orange color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.

When working with #c69860,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.

For web development, #c69860 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#c69860), RGB (rgb(198, 152, 96)), HSL (hsl(33, 47%, 58%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cc9966,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
